Oranje Nassau Energie

Wellsite Geologist.

Conventional vertical and deviated drilling in the Dutch offshore into chalk, claystone, sandstone and evaporites. Realtime L/MWD interpretation and correlation using Gamma, Resisitivity, Neutron Density, Neutron Porosity, Nuclear Magnetic Resonance and Sonic. Identifying coring and casing points. Supervision of cutting, retrieval and onsite processing of core. Lithologicial descriptions of core chips, drilled cuttings and cavings (including hydrocarbon shows analysis where relevant). Supervision of Wireline operations including formation pressure testing and spectral gamma ray logging. Supervision of Mudlogging and LWD team. Production of daily geological report. Production of wellsite lithological log and composite well log (using LogPlot7).

In the office; production of the end of well reports and post mortem reports, QC fnal well reports from some service companies, production of final composite logs, attend and present at DWOP meetings.
